The War Against Indiscipline (WAI) was a mass mobilisation program in Nigeria aimed at correcting social maladjustment and corruption. It was officially launched in March 1984. It was a hallmark initiative of the military government of Major General Muhammadu Buhari (1983–1985). The program was announced by his second-in-command, Brigadier General Tunde Idiagbon.
The campaign promoted orderliness, such as queuing correctly for buses, and instilled a strong work ethic and national unity. It also mandated the prominent display of the national flag and the singing of the national anthem in schools.
